🎫 🖼️ Art & Exhibits
The museum houses a significant collection of paintings, including religious art, works by Giambattista Tiepolo, Alvise Vivarini, and Veneziano, alongside furniture and drawings. :art:
The religious paintings, particularly those on the ground floor, are renowned for their beautiful restoration and historical significance, offering a powerful visual experience. :pray:
Yes, the museum features an excellent permanent selection of ink and watercolors on paper by Giambattista Tiepolo. :pencil:
Museo Sartorio occasionally hosts temporary exhibitions, often focusing on local artists or historical themes, so it's worth checking their schedule. :newspaper:
The collections span various periods, with a strong emphasis on Renaissance and Baroque art, as well as 19th-century decorative arts reflecting the villa's era. :scroll:

A Glimpse into the Sartorio Collection
Complementing the paintings are collections of period furniture and drawings, offering a comprehensive look into the life and times of the villa's former inhabitants. The overall atmosphere is one of elegant preservation, allowing visitors to feel as though they've stepped back into the 19th century. The historic rooms themselves are part of the exhibit, showcasing the grandeur of noble residences from that era.
For those seeking specific artistic highlights, keep an eye out for the 'Madonna and Child with Angels Playing Music' by Alvise Vivarini (circa 1489) and two gorgeous paintings by Veneziano. These pieces, alongside the Tiepolo works, form the core of the museum's artistic appeal, making it a must-visit for art enthusiasts in Trieste.
